marianna riekkinen - Infectious Diseases

Author Information

Marianna Riekkinen is affiliated with multiple esteemed institutions, including the Meilahti Vaccine Research Center (MeVac) at the University of Helsinki and Helsinki University Hospital. She is also associated with the Department of Infectious Diseases at the Inflammation Center of Helsinki University Hospital. In addition, she contributes to research at the Human Microbiome Research Unit at the University of Helsinki and offers her expertise at the Travel Clinic, Aava Medical Center, in Helsinki, Finland. Her work is primarily focused on infectious diseases, contributing significantly to the understanding and management of COVID-19.

Research Contributions

Marianna Riekkinen has made notable contributions to the study of infectious diseases, particularly in the context of the COVID-19 pandemic. Her research includes examining the kinetics of neutralizing antibodies in COVID-19 patients using various clinical isolates in microneutralization assays. She has also explored the reduced neutralization capabilities of convalescent sera against emerging variants of SARS-CoV-2, such as the B.1.351 variant. Her work is crucial in understanding the immune responses to different strains of the virus, contributing valuable insights into vaccine development and therapeutic strategies.
